Default Camping in Uwharrie this weekend/week

So I took a week off for vacation this weekend and next week, so I figured I would take a nice long camping trip by myself for a week. I'm up in Uwharrie National forest, btw, this place is just amazing. If you live in NC and are close, it's a place you need to go to.

Anyway, there are a crap load of OHV trails here. Most of them are for the hardcore rock crawlers and off roaders, but of course there are some easy to Moderate ones. Well I bought my trail passes for the next 4 days, only $5 per day. Got all 4 plastered on my rear window ready to do.

I've got my buddies recovery kit and Hi-Lift, so I'm ready. Last weekend I made it thru the easiest one with no problem (with 5 people in my truck) so I can't wait to see what I can get myself into tomorrow and the next week
